MATLAB社区

MATLAB,社区等

文件交换相关内容

问题:你如何找到你不一定要找的东西?
答:您可以查看“其他也已下载”标题下列出的相关内容。

我们最近在文件交换中添加了一个新的“相关内容”功能。它可以帮助你顺利地从一个项目转移到其他相关项目。我发现它支持一个发现工作流程,万博1manbetx也就是说,你从一个关于你想做什么的想法开始,但它会有机地演变成不同但更好的东西。让我用一个故事来说明。

我喜欢飞机。许多年前,我接受了航空航天工程师的培训。这就是我学习MATLAB的原因!不管怎样,这是一架飞机即将着陆的照片。

它看起来与跑道不是很一致,但是我们应该告诉飞行员怎么做呢?我们如何精确地确定飞机相对于跑道的方向?为了给我们的平面建模,我们需要一种方法来指定它的方向。为此,我们使用欧拉角.欧拉角是以数学超级英雄莱昂哈德·欧拉的名字命名的,因为他的姓听起来像“油匠”,我一直认为他的家乡瑞士巴塞尔应该有一支名为巴塞尔欧拉的冰球队。但我不是来谈这个的。

欧拉角可以用于任何物体,但当你所描述的物体与任何固定的参考系分离时,欧拉角尤其有用。对于在(或多或少)二维空间中移动的汽车,您可能只需要担心指南针航向(方位角)。重力使飞行器保持在地面上。但是像飞机和宇宙飞船这样的东西可以指向任何方向。因此,我们可以使用偏航(用于航向)、俯仰(用于机头的抬高)、滚转(用于绕长轴旋转)的角度。这些是欧拉角。

很难想象这些角度是如何工作的,所以让我们应用MATLAB。与其自己编写什么东西,不如看看File Exchange。经过快速搜索欧拉角,这个标题引起了我的注意:《海绵宝宝》变成了3d版通过安东尼奥Tristán维加西班牙巴利亚多利德大学教授。安东尼奥知道海绵宝宝可以照亮任何任务,包括在三维空间中建模刚体的方向。

我下载了它,安装了它(它取决于另外两个提交)并运行它。这就是我所看到的。

我做了一些调整。很高兴!但我也注意到,在这个条目的文件交换页面上,右边有一个小框,就在标签下面:“其他也已下载”。它会显示下载这个文件的人下载的其他文件。这将显示相关内容,并为我省去返回搜索结果页面的麻烦。

上面清单上的第三个是飞行可视化条目的格斯布朗.看起来很有趣。这不是我最初想要的,但我想试一试。这一次,我决定使用Add-On Explorer直接从MATLAB内部下载它。Add-On Explorer基本上是文件交换的产品内视图。它向您显示所有相同的内容,但是当您单击Add按钮时,它的优点是只需单击一下就可以下载条目、安装它并将其放到路径上。超级方便。

在我让它运行后,这是飞行可视化条目在我的电脑上看起来的样子。

非常光滑的!那架F-4幻影看起来比海绵宝宝更符合空气动力学。我玩了一下F-4,但我心不在焉的目光又一次找到了页面的相关内容部分。

人工地平线,是吗?值得一看。我点击链接并安装文件,很快我就看到了MATLAB版本的座舱仪表这显示了飞机的方向。该文件是由Eric ogy

当然,我想测试一下它的性能。我想用一些真实的飞行数据来展示。但是从哪里获取数据呢?就在那时,我有了一个奇妙的头脑风暴:我可以用MATLAB Mobile生成我自己的飞行数据!我启动了我的MATLAB Mobile副本,并通过连接器将其连接到我的桌面MATLAB。然后我转到应用程序的传感器页面,开始将方位角、俯仰角和倾斜角(我们的老欧拉角朋友)流式传输到MATLAB。

然后我所要做的就是让我的手机像飞机一样飞几秒钟。我的手机在办公室里嗡嗡地飞。数据流进入MATLAB,我很快就能用人工地平线代码将结果可视化。下面是结果的动画。

结果出来了。一个不可思议的发现之旅,由查看相关内容并快速安装的能力驱动。我应该指出的是,现在我已经完成了这个任务,插件管理器也可以很容易地卸载你已经完成的文件。来得容易,去得快。就该是这样。

|
  • 打印
  • 发送电子邮件

评论

如欲留言,请点击在这里登录您的MathWorks帐户或创建一个新帐户。